Firestorm, DICE and the EA publisher have now decided to remove this option, saying that there simply was not enough players using the mode.

"Duo provoked an extremely positive reaction to the launch," said Adam Freeman, head of the EA community, about the Battlefield 5 subreddit (thanks, VG24 / 7). "It debuted during a weekend, and it was initially only a beginner for fashion." Duo was originally designed as a limited-time offering similar to Grind and Rush, and presented as a limited content in Chapter 3.

"When Duo was removed for the first time, you told us that you wanted to see him come back and that we were happy to support him, and since then we have seen more and more people come back to Squads mode, with a preference less for Firestorm in Duo – so we will go back to the original plan today and we have disabled it is the twinning (sic). "

Although this may not have gone away for good – "as with other limited time modes, we never say, we are confident we will see it again!" – for the moment, it is not planned to reintroduce the option at a later date. Many fans have expressed their frustration with this decision, voting downward on the subject and claiming that without the duo's option, they would return to other royal battle games like Call of Duty: Blackout 4 and PUGB in place.

When asked if the mode could remain as long as players lining up to participate are warned that there might be a lengthy wait, Freeman added: "This is not an impossible thing to do, but it's probably not the most sensible thing to do … doing a better job is to advertise more clearly (here and in the game) what content is available for a limited time and when you can expect to what he leaves Battlefield.

"We really have a lot of things to show and discuss with Firestorm on EA Play," he later added in the thread, referring to the consumer E3 show that will take place next month, "and if that reintroduced the need to get Duos back, we think for sure the best way and the best time to do it […] Whether we do it on some weekends every month or for a week to celebrate each future Firestorm update, you'll see Duo again.

To be very fair to people though, and as transparent as possible, we do not expect this to come back as a permanent addition. "
